TURN-208: Gatevale turnstile counters at the Merrow Field pilot double-count when a rotation reverses mid-cycle. Attendance totals drift roughly 2% high per event. The debounce window fix is implemented, reviewed by Ilsa, and soak-tested across two simulated match days without drift. Ready for your cut; the candidate build is identified below.

trace token, tagag-tafog: htk6_5ed18c

**Facilities Ticket — Shuttle-Bus Gate, Norfell Campus**

Priority: Medium

Hi reception team — the pedestrian gate by the shuttle-bus stop on the east side keeps sticking again, so drivers are letting people through the vehicle barrier, which we'd rather avoid. Quillon Maintenance are coming Thursday to sort the hinge. Until then, please direct anyone waiting for the Ferndale shuttle through the side gate by the bike shed. They'll need the gate code, which is:

badge for hahip-bagag: bdg-FIJ-9

// Catalog cache invalidation client (Shelfmint internal)
// Support team: this client talks to the Purgely invalidation service.
// When a product record changes upstream, we enqueue a purge; stale
// entries otherwise linger up to 6 hours. Do NOT trigger manual
// purges for entire categories during peak hours — it hammers the
// origin. The client needs a service credential at startup or it
// falls back to read-only mode and purges silently no-op.
// The credential for the Purgely service is on the next line.

service key, fawip-bajef: kto11_Qt5wZK9vdNC

**Vendor note: Inkmill markdown pipeline**

Rendering for Parchway docs is outsourced to Inkmill under an annual contract, renewing each March. They handle sanitization and PDF export; we own the upload queue. SLA: 4-hour response on rendering failures. Escalate only after two failed retries. Their support desk is reachable at the address below.

billing contact of hahaf-baguf = zorael.tammir.jorius@sivrelhq.internal

Night shift staff at Dunmere Logistics should note that the key cabinet for pool cars, located in the transport office on the ground floor, must remain locked at all times when unattended. Each key taken must be recorded in the logbook, including vehicle number, time out, and expected return. Visitors, including contractors, may never be given pool car keys directly; a staff member must handle the transaction and record it. To open the cabinet during night hours, use the access code below.

turnstile pass: bdg-NZJSS-18109